River Journey November 1998

Journal Notes from the November 1998 Float to the Sea:

DAY 6-7
(Nov 10-11)
in Vicksburg
Captain Dave Schaeffer of Mississippi River Adventures let me camp on his loading barge, which was a much welcome relief to sandbars, and furthermore is conveniently located in downtown Vicksburg, at the foot of Clay Street. His sister Margaret helps him run the business, along with Marlene and a retired Army Corps revetment director, George, who introduced himself to me as "First Mate George."
